Just like their U.S. counterparts, British writers fear an A.I. future. The use of A.I. has been among the major sticking points in the ongoing U.S. writers strike and a WGGB survey today reveals 6…
will reduce their writing incomes. Nearly the same number are worried generative systems could replace their jobs.
Fear around the potential for A.I.’s use in creative areas such as screenwriting has been growing in the UK, with an early impact assessment from OpenAI suggesting poets, lyricists and creative writers were among the most exposed to risk fro the technology.
